APPOINTMENTS TO BE MADE.
SURVEYOR — Applications to be lodged with the Chairman of the Commission on Roads and their Deviations. For information as to qualifications, &c., apply to the Chief Engineer of Roads on or before Saturday the 19th December inst.
A MESSENGER. Apply by noon of 16th December current, to the Provincial Secretary.
TENDERS will be received at the Provincial Secretary’s office up to four o’clock on the 1st instant; for the undermentioned supply of Forage, to be delivered at the Teviot Station in such quantities as may be required by the officer in charge of the Districts:
About 5 tons Hay or Chaff,
100 bushels Oats (Colonial), and
20 bushels Bran.
THOMAS DICK,
Provincial Secretary.
Dunedin, 7th December, 1863.
TENDERS will be received at the office of the Secretary of Public Works until noon of Tuesday, the 15th Dec., for the supply of 300 cubic yards of metal on the Road, Northern Trunk, to Port Chalmers.
Specifications can be seen, and forms of tender obtained, at the office of the Road Engineer’s Department.
GEORGE DUNCAN,
Secretary of Public Works.
Dunedin, 8th Dec., 1863.
TENDERS will be received at the office of the Secretary of Public Works until noon of Tuesday, the 15th of Dec., for the supply of 800 cubic yards of metal on a portion of the Main North Trunk, commencing at the 4th, and terminating at the 6th, mile-post from Dunedin.
Specifications can be seen, and forms of tender obtained, at the office of the Road Engineer’s Department.
GEORGE DUNCAN,
Secretary of Public Works.
Dunedin, 8th Dec., 1863.
NORTHERN TRUNK ROAD.
Waikouaiti to Shag River.
TENDERS will be received at the office of the Secretary of Public Works until noon on Tuesday, the 22nd day of Dec., 1863, for the construction of about 2 miles and 60 chains of the Northern Trunk Road, through the Hawksbury District.
Plans and specifications can be seen, and forms of tender obtained, at the office of the Road Engineer, Dunedin.
GEORGE DUNCAN,
Secretary of Public Works.
Dunedin, 8th Dec., 1863.
SOUTHERN TRUNK ROAD.
Tokomairiro River to Clutha Ferry.
TENDERS will be received at the office of the Secretary of Public Works until noon on Tuesday, the 15th day of December, for the construction of a lock-up at West Taieri.
Plans and specifications may be seen and forms of tender obtained at the office of the Provincial Engineer.
GEORGE DUNCAN,
Secretary of Public Works.
Dunedin, December 5, 1863.
TENDERS will be received at the office of the Secretary of Public Works until noon on Tuesday, the 22nd day of Dec., instant, for the supply of stone for pitching and for road metal for about 4 miles of the Southern Trunk Road, between south branch of the Tokomairiro River and the crossing of Lovell’s Creek.
Specifications can be seen, and forms of tender obtained, at the office of the Road Engineer, Dunedin.
GEORGE DUNCAN,
Secretary of Public Works.
Dunedin, 8th Dec., 1863.
